Output 70b43e6e5393d7bbf5018bd3eea4540e140bb26c711d05cd9e660ae672c44ee7:20

value
7595202
script pubkey
OP_0 OP_PUSHBYTES_20 efba6893f2783cada2bd1d628a1752ab1ed17f47
address
ltc1qa7ax3ylj0q72mg4ar43g596j4v0dzl68emm8th
transaction
70b43e6e5393d7bbf5018bd3eea4540e140bb26c711d05cd9e660ae672c44ee7
spent
true